Planets are not stationary, they carry huge angular momentum in their rotation and revolution. In the overall angular momentum of the solar system, the angular momentum of the sun itself only accounts for 2%, and the other 98% of the angular momentum is controlled by the surrounding. Sun in astral hands.

When the mining spacecraft cuts into the planet's orbit, it also gets a part of the planet's angular momentum, and the transferred angular momentum is reflected in the speed change when the spacecraft flies out of the planet's gravitational field.

Taking the sun as a reference, the speed at which the spacecraft flew out of the planet at this time not only changed its direction, but also increased its size.

Because according to the law of conservation of energy, the kinetic energy added by the spacecraft is also the kinetic energy reduced by the planet, but the kinetic energy of the planet is too huge, and the kinetic energy shared by the small spacecraft is only a drop in the bucket compared to it.
